Scented Geranium, 'Citronella' | Pelargonium 'Citronella'

Mature Height: 24 inches
Mature Spread: 12 - 18 inches
Spacing: 12 - 18 inches
Hardiness Zone: 9 - 11
Exposure: Full Sun, Part Sun
Bloom Time: Summer
This scented geranium exudes the familiar "citronella" scent you smell in candles and oils to repel insects. While the citronella oil you buy in the store comes from lemongrass, which has a higher concentration of the oil, this scented geranium also contains the repellent chemical in smaller quantities.
As a tender perennial, grow in pots that you can move in and outdoors as the seasons change. In most zones, this plant will not survive outdoors in the colder months. Place pots of this geranium around your patio, deck or outdoor eating area for a natural repellent and enjoy its lovely, delicate lavender/pink blooms throughout the summer. Deadhead throughout the season and trim back stems to encourage bushier growth.
